编程语言-周排行
java业务的过程_写一个java业务需要的步骤 ————————————————————————————————————————————————————先写bean包里的bean 再写dao interface xxxMapper @repository 定义个借口方法 int insert(si ...
要使用priority_queue需要先包含头文件#include<queue>,相比queue,优先队列可以自定义数据的优先级,让优先级高的排在队列前面。 优先队列的基本操作: empty:查看优先队列是否为空 size:返回优先队列的长度 top:查看堆顶的元素 push:插入一个元素 empl ...
?# 1. 冒泡排序 冒泡排序概述 一种排序的方式,对要进行排序的数据中相邻的数据进行两两比较,将较大的数据放在后面,依次对所 有的数据进行操作,直至所有数据按要求完成排序 如果有n个数据进行排序,总共需要比较n-1次 每一次比较完毕,下一次的比较就会少一个数据参与 2. 冒泡排序代码实现(理解) ...
全是自己平时淘宝(github)的时候看到的一些优秀的插件。我对优秀的定义其实也很简单,无任何依赖(比如不依赖jquery),star很高,保持活跃 通知 目前就觉得两款比较牛 noty https://github.com/needim/noty ...
对象列表相对于调用者显示不同的标记(Tag),当然也可以在父类当中添加属性,再动态赋值。 但对在用的系统,为了某个应用添加一堆没大用的空列我本人不爽,就直接做了个子类继承父类,增加两个标记属性。 @EqualsAndHashCode(callSuper = true) @Data @AllArgsC ...
condition类里内置了一把RLock锁,有acquire方法和release方法,还有wait,notify,notifyAll方法, 使用acquire方法可以获得RLock锁 使用wait方法就会放掉锁并处于阻塞状态,等其他线程中有使用notify方法时,在wait前的acquire方法处 ...
//.h文件 void toTray();//最小化到托盘 void DeleteTray();//删除托盘图标 afx_msg LRESULT OnShowTask(WPARAM wParam,LPARAM lParam) ;//图标恢复 //.cpp文件 #define WM_SHOWTASK ...
在java工程中,一般我们会用Utils或Tools的包名来封装一些通用的工具类。单单从字面上来看,两者都可以表示工具的意思,但往往并不能做出比较精准的定义。以下是本人对utils包与tools包的定义及理解: 定义:包名 定义 方法或属性 举例utils 通用的且与项目业务无关的类的组合;可供其他 ...
javaServer.sh #!/bin/bash export JAVA_HOME=/u01/java_home/jdk1.8.0_131 export APP_HOME=/u01/app export APP_NAME=test.jar export PROG=test function get ...
JAVA基础总结 1. 基础语法 数据类型 基本数据类型: 整数:byte short int long 浮点数:float double 字符:char 布尔值:boolean 引用数据类型: 类 接口 数组 其他 类型转换: 自动类型转换:低转高 强制类型转换:高转低 变量和常量: 变量: ty ...
1. 字典自定义排序 首先按值降序排序,若值相等,则按键升序排序。 2. 题解 Python内置函数sorted,然后设定排序规则,对于键-x[1],对于值x[0]。 这里输出的是list,根据需要转换成dict即可。 nums = sorted(nums_dict.items(), key=lam ...
单条插入语句:insert into cloude_5.user_9 (id,name,password,sex) values ('70cd7b9e-1ec1-3cca-fb49-6b6b6d4657e2','大明','14e1b600b1fd579f47433b88e8d85291','男') ...
import threading from time import sleep class Item: def __init__(self, x): self.x = x def add(self): self.x += 1 x = Item(100) class RWLock: def __ini ...
Properties 类是 Hashtable 的子类,该对象用于处理属性文件 由于属性文件里的 key、value 都是字符串类型,所以 Properties 里的 key 和 value 都是字符串类型 存取数据时,建议使用 etProperty(String key, String value ...
1.精度方面的转换 1.1低精度转到高精度 自动转换 int a; short b = 10, c =10; a = 10 + b; //结果为20,10与 short类型运算,short会自动转换成int a = b + c; //结果为20,两个低精度运算,会自动转换成int 1.2高精度转低精 ...
do…while循环 对于while语句而言,如果不满足条件,则不能进入循环。但有时候我们需要即使不满足条件,也至少 执行一次。 do…while循环和while循环相同,不同的是, do…while循环至少会执行一次。 package com.example.lesson1; //do{// // ...
1.缩进表示块结构。如for,while,begin,end, if-else等。 2.while,for,repeat-until等循环结构以及if-else等条件结构与C,C++,Java,Python,和Pascal中的那些结构具有类似的解释。 3.符号“//”表示该行后面部分是个注释。 4. ...
输出一个集合 List<Integer> list = Arrays.asList("AA", "BB"); 直接输出 for (int i = 0; i < list.size(); ++i){ System.out.println(list.get(i)); } foreach遍历输出 for ...
前提 你得知道Spring创建Bean的基本流程,我们这里解释的是Spring创建Bean时使用有参构造器去创建Bean的源码解析。 autowireConstructor方法 这个方法里面就是拿到类的构造器,然后选取到最合适的,然后进而通过构造器来进行初始化。 方法总览 没想到很好的表达方式,就把 ...
前言 这是真正意义上的第一次上机实操,初步的学习了pycharm的使用及各种快捷键 学习资源 https://www.bilibili.com/video/BV1B7411J7xo?from=search&seid=4173566208543366476&spm_id_from=333.337.0. ...